      <description>&lt;h1 id=&#34;units-of-measurement-in-storage-vs-networking&#34;&gt;Units of measurement in storage vs networking&lt;/h1&gt;&#xA;&lt;p&gt;A common mistake that engineers do when referring to storage capacities is that they use the network bandwidth units instead of the storage units; They think that 1 MB is one Miegabyte of storage. That is incorrect. Storage capacities should be written using the IEC notation:&lt;/p&gt;&#xA;&lt;ul&gt;&#xA;&lt;li&gt;1 kiB: one kibibyte&lt;/li&gt;&#xA;&lt;li&gt;1 MiB: one mebibyte&lt;/li&gt;&#xA;&lt;li&gt;1 GiB: one gibibyte&lt;/li&gt;&#xA;&lt;li&gt;1 TiB: one tebibyte&lt;/li&gt;&#xA;&lt;li&gt;etc.&lt;/li&gt;&#xA;&lt;/ul&gt;&#xA;&lt;p&gt;To express communication speed, throughput or bandwidth, values must be written using this notation:&lt;/p&gt;</description>
